• Do not leave appliance when plugged in. Unplug
from outlet when not in use and before servicing.
• WARNING: ELECTRIC SHOCK COULD
OCCUR IF USED OUTDOORS OR ON WET
SURFACES.
• Do not allow to be used as a toy. Close
attention is necessary when used by or near
children.
• Use only as described in this manual. Use only
manufacturer’s recommended attachments.
• Do not use with damaged cord or plug. If
appliance is not working as it should, has been
dropped, damaged, left outdoors, or dropped into
water, return it to your retailer for service.
• Do not pull or carry by cord, use cord as a
handle, close a door on the cord, or pull cord
around sharp edges or corners. Do not run
appliance over cord. Keep cord away from heated
surfaces.
• Do not unplug by pulling on cord. To unplug,
grasp the plug, not the cord.
• Do not handle plug or appliance with wet hands.
• Do not put any object into openings. Do
not use with any opening blocked; keep
free of dust, lint, hair and anything that may
reduce air ow.
• Keep hair, loose clothing, ngers and all
parts of body away from openings and
moving parts.
• Do not pick up anything that is burning or
smoking, such as cigarettes, matches or hot
ashes.
• Do not use without vacuum bag and/or
lters in place.
• Turn off all controls before unplugging.
• Use extra care when cleaning on stairs.
• Do not use to pick up ammable or
combustible liquids such as gasoline or use
in areas where they may be present.
• Do not attempt to service the unit while
appliance is plugged in.
• Do not pull cord out of canister beyond
the yellow tape.
